CORRECTED - PREVIEW-Japan may meet CO2 goals, but only due to recession
(Corrects third bullet point to say 100 million tonnes, not 10 million tonnes. The first correction made clear in paragraph nine that the Japan firm is a joint venture, not a unit)
* What: Japanese greenhouse gas emissions for 1st Kyoto year
* When: announcement expected as early as this week
* Greenhouse gases seen down 100 million tonnes at 1.27 bln
* Meeting 2008-2012 goals hinge on forests, nuclear run rate
* No policy drivers yet for emission cuts when economy grows
By Risa Maeda
TOKYO, Nov 9 (Reuters) - Japan is expected to report as early as this week that its greenhouse gas emissions sank last year, the first year of its Kyoto Protocol obligations. Continued...
